The Justice Mill

A child friendly bar serving food with WiFi in Aberdeen.

The rear of these premises opens out onto Justice Mill Lane, which takes its name from two medieval mills situated in the vicinity of the early courts of justice.

Corncrake Golden Ale 4.1 Orkney Brewery

A Straw gold Session ale

Tasting Notes: Crisp hops perfectly balance the biscuity maris otter to provide a thirst quenching ale with soft citrus( apricot and peach) flavours throughout. Corncrake is named after the rare and elusive bird which enjoys the natural habitats of Orkney. A donation from the sale of each bottle goes to support the RSPB's Corncrake conservation work in Scotland.
